Appointment of IIUI new president: 17th board of trustees meeting held

ISLAMABAD-UNS: The 17th Board of Trustees (BoT) meeting of the International Islamic University, Islamabad (IIUI) was held online, chaired by the Chancellor of the University, President of Pakistan, Asif Ali Zardari.

The meeting formally confirmed the minutes of the 16th BoT meeting held on December 23, 2024, at Imam Muhammad bin Saud Islamic University, Riyadh. A key agenda item of this meeting was the finalization of the appointment of the President of IIUI, in accordance with the resolutions of the 16th BoT meeting, which had stipulated the formation of a head-hunting committee to shortlist candidates for the position.

The committee finalized three names, which were presented to the BoT by the Acting Rector of IIUI, H.E. Prof. Dr. Mukhtar Ahmed. The shortlisted candidates were:

• Dr. Ahmed Saad Nasser Al-Ahmed

• Dr. Sarosh Hashmat Lodhi

• Dr. Muhammad Jahanzeb Khan

The BoT selected Dr. Ahmed Saad Nasser Al-Ahmed as the new President of IIUI.

The meeting was also attended by Prof. Dr. Ahmad Salem Mohammad Al-Ameri, Pro-Chancellor of IIUI and Rector of Imam Muhammad bin Saud Islamic University.
